The respiratory system is crucial for exchanging oxygen (O2) and carbon dioxide (CO2) between the atmosphere and the bloodstream, maintaining the body's balance. Beyond gas exchange, it helps regulate acid-base balance, purify inhaled air, and enable vocalization.
